Spinal cord injury claims are frequently fought on details: what happened first, when symptoms were recognized, and whether treatment followed promptly. In Peoria, those questions often connect to local realities—commuter traffic, winter road conditions, and workplaces where reporting delays can occur.
That’s why “calculator math” can feel frustrating. Two people can enter the same symptom category but end up with very different outcomes based on:
- How quickly emergency care and imaging occurred after the incident
- Whether follow-up rehab and specialist treatment were consistent
- How well the incident story matches medical findings
- How insurers interpret gaps in documentation
A responsible calculator helps you organize questions. A lawyer helps you turn the answers into evidence that holds up.
